What is a CNC operator machine operator?

CNC Operator Machine Operators are skilled technicians who set up, operate, and maintain computer numerical control (CNC) machines used in manufacturing. They read blueprints or technical drawings, load materials, input specifications into the CNC equipment, and monitor the production process to ensure parts meet quality standards. They also perform routine maintenance, troubleshoot issues, and make minor adjustments to keep machines running smoothly. Attention to detail and mechanical aptitude are important qualities for this role.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as a CNC operator machine operator?

To thrive as a CNC Operator/Machine Operator, you need a solid understanding of machining processes, blueprint reading, and basic math, often supported by a high school diploma or technical certification. Familiarity with CNC programming software, measurement tools like calipers and micrometers, and safety protocols is essential. Attention to detail, problem-solving, and strong communication skills distinguish top performers in this role. These skills ensure precise manufacturing, minimize errors, and maintain efficient and safe production environments.

What are some common challenges faced by CNC operator machine operators and how can they be addressed?

CNC Machine Operators often encounter challenges such as maintaining precision during long production runs, troubleshooting machine malfunctions, and adapting to new equipment or updated software. Effective communication with maintenance teams and engineers is key when issues arise, and following strict quality control protocols helps prevent errors. Continuous learning and staying updated on machine technologies can help operators adapt quickly and improve efficiency, making the role both dynamic and rewarding.

The main difference between a Cnc Operator and a Machine Setter is that CNC Operators primarily run and monitor CNC machines, focusing on production and quality control. Machine Setters are responsible for preparing and setting up machines before production begins. Both roles require technical skills and certifications, but Machine Setters often handle machine calibration and setup, while CNC Operators focus on operation and troubleshooting during manufacturing.

CNC Technician position serves as an upper level of a CNC Operator. The CNC Operator is held to certain criteria as defined in the CNC Operator job description. The CNC Operator must meet these criteria along with the requirements listed below before he or she can be considered for the position of a CNC Technician.

SPECIFIC RESPONSIBILITIES:

  1. Must be able to establish and set tool lengths, including oversize bars.
  2. Must be able to establish fixed probe TRAM surface.
  3. Must be able to calibrate spindle probe manually.
  4. Must understand the controls of all machines.
  5. Must have the ability to operate all machines.
  6. Must be able to use shop math to figure depth of cut.
  7. Must be able to make non-complex adjustments.
  8. Must be able to read and understand program lines.
  9. Must be able to make slight edits and tool adjustments.
  10. Must be able to look at the condition of the cut and know how to remedy any problems.
  11. Must be able to change tools and inserts.
  12. Must be able to setup secondary operations where applicable.
  13. Must be able to read and understand prints.
  14. Must be able to use all measuring devices.
  15. Use of assembly fixtures, drill press, Arbor press, air hoses, miscellaneous hand tools, air dryer, ratchets, hammer, vise, manual material handling devices, lift tables, roller conveyers, and hoists.
  16. Must be able to make radical edits to programs if required.
  17. Must be able to troubleshoot machine problems.
  18. Must have knowledge of simple trigonometric functions related to setup of parts and edits to programs.
  19. Maintain a working knowledge of feeds / speeds and the ability to determine chip loads.
  20. Must demonstrate good problem solving abilities related to the machines and parts utilized within the department.
  21. Must aide in the development of the CNC operators in relation to the requirements of their position.
  22. Must aide in the scheduling of the department.
  23. Must work closely with the departmental supervisor by communicating conditions of inventory, quality, machine performance, and maintenance issues.
  24. Must have a working knowledge of programming in machine language.

MINIMUM REQUIREMENTS:

Must have 2 years technical school and a minimum of 1 year of experience or the equivalent knowledge.
